Butternut Squash Soup

6 servings

servings

1 hour 5 minutes

total time

Ingredients

For the soup:

1 medium yellow onion, chopped (about 1 cup)

1 celery rib, chopped (about 3/4 cup)

1 carrot, chopped (about 3/4 cup)

2 tablespoons unsalted butter

1 butternut squash, peeled and chopped (6 to 8 cups), seeds discarded (see How to Peel and Cut a Butternut Squash)

1 large tart green apple, peeled, cored, chopped (squash to apple ratio should be 3:1)

3 cups chicken stock or broth (or vegetable broth)

1 cup water

Pinches of nutmeg, cinnamon, cayenne, salt and pepper

For the garnish (optional):

Fresh parsley, chopped

Chives, chopped

Dash of smoked paprika

Sour cream

Directions

Sauté the onion, carrot, and celery in butter: Heat a large thick-bottomed pot on medium-high heat. Melt the butter in the pot and let it foam up and recede. Add the onion, carrot, and celery and sauté for 5 minutes. Lower the heat if the vegetables begin to brown.

Cook the soup: Add the butternut squash, apple, stock, and water. Bring to boil. Reduce to a simmer, cover, and simmer for 30 minutes or so, until the squash and carrots have softened.

Purée the soup: Use an immersion blender to purée the soup, or work in batches and purée the soup in a stand blender.
